AC Ajaccio Rodez for the 28th day of Ligue 2, at the François-Coty stadium.

With a final result of 1 to 0, the Ajacciens won this meeting.

Pantaloni's squad played in a balanced 4-2-3-1, with Moussiti Oko at the forefront in front of the rather offensive Ruthenian 3-5-2 of Peyrelade.

In the first half, no goal was scored.

The meeting was not rich in goals.

The only achievement was registered in the 90th by Njike.

The players made a lot of mistakes that the referee must have whistled.

Ouhafsa received a yellow card, as did Bayala, Barreto, Peyrelade, El Idrissy and Sanaia.

Thanks to this result, AC Ajaccio passes in front of Nancy and now temporarily occupies 9th place.

Rodez temporarily fell to 15th place, losing 2 places following this defeat.

The meeting in brief

AC Ajaccio - Rodez: 1-0 (0-0 at half-time)

In Ajaccio (François-Coty stadium), on March 2, kick-off at 8 p.m.

Rodez trainer: Laurent Peyrelade

Composition of Rodez: Lionel Mpasi-Nzau (16), Valentin Henry (28) (then Alexis Peyrelade in the 86th), Johann Obiang (23) (then Nassim Ouammou in the 86th), Nathanaël Dieng (17), Amiran Sanaia (13 ), Julien Celestine (2), David Douline (22), Jordan Leborgne (18) (then Loïc Poujol in the 83rd), Rémy Boissier (6), Ayoub Ouhafsa (26) (then Florian David in the 69th), Malaly Dembélé (9) (then Ugo Bonnet in the 69th)

Coach of AC Ajaccio: Olivier Pantaloni

Composition of AC Ajaccio: Benjamin Leroy (1), Cédric Avinel (21) (then Matthieu Huard in the 60th), Ismaël Jean Chester Diallo (3), Gédéon Kalulu (2), Mohamed Youssouf (20), Mathieu Coutadeur ( 6), Mickaël Barreto (4), Bévic Selad Moussiti Oko (25) (then Gaëtan Courtet in the 80th), Tony Njike (17), Cyrille Bayala (14), Mounaïm El Idrissy (7) (then Faiz Mattoir in the 84th )

Goals: Njike (90th)

Warnings: Barreto (58th), Bayala (61st), El Idrissy (62nd) for AC Ajaccio, Ouhafsa (43rd), Sanaia (55th), Peyrelade (87th) for Rodez

No player sent off
